497,372 is a composite number, even.
497,372 (four hundred ninety-seven thousand three hundred seventy-two) is an even 6-digit number. It is a composite number with 6 divisors, and factors as 2² × 124,343. Written other ways, in hexadecimal, 0x796DC.
